Problems tuning in: Intro file plays, then stream stops

Question:
When listeners tune in, they only hear the intro MP3 and then playback stops.

Answer:
Your intro MP3 is probably recorded at a different bitrate than the MP3s your stream is configured to play.  For example, if your stream is configured at 128Kbps, then your intro MP3 and all of your stream MP3s must also be recorded at 128Kbps.

To correct this problem, you'll need to re-encode your intro file at the same bit rate as the MP3s that you plan to stream, or the stream you plan to relay.
